Solution Overview

Problem

Existing foldable stool sample collection devices face challenges in providing a stable platform for receiving fecal matter while minimizing urine contamination and preventing samples from falling into the toilet bowl, especially when made from a single strip of foldable material.

Innovation Solution

A foldable stool sample collection device comprising an elongate sheet of foldable material with a central strip and lateral strips, adhesive pads for securing it to the toilet seat, and a urine pass-through area with openings to prevent urine mixing, along with folds that provide stability and upstanding lateral strips to prevent sample slippage.

PatentEP3028646B1Foldable stool sample collection device
Publication Date: 2019.03.27 DAKLAPACK EURO

AI summary

The invention provides a stool sample collection device (1) to be mounted on a toilet seat (12) for receiving a stool sample from a person, the stool sample collecting device comprises an elongate sheet of foldable material (2) provided with multiple adhesive pads (9) for securing the elongate sheet to the toilet seat. According to the invention, the stool sample collecting device is configured to provide a stable platform for receiving and supporting a stool sample. Therefore, the elongate sheet comprises a central strip (6) and two lateral strips (7), which central strip extends in the longitudinal direction of the elongate sheet, and which lateral strips are located adjacent to and adjoining the central strip. A fold (8) is present in the elongate sheet as a joint between each lateral strip and the central strip.
